Abstract:By using the equations of kinetic and available potential energy in the wave-number domain, mechanism for the maintenance of the zonal mean flow and ultra-long waves at the 200-hPa level over the tropics from June 11 to August 13,1983, is analysed with the ECMWF/WMO data. The result shows that the tropical easterlies in summer are barotropically stable. The waves are found to transfer kinetic energy to the mean flow. In the interaction between the various waves, the wave of wavenumber 2 plays the role of an energy source. The work done by the lateral pressure force and the lateral convergence are also important in the maintenance of the ultra-long waves in the tropics.
